MONTEIRO, Tobias was born in July 1866 in Natal, State of Rio Grande do Norte. Son of Jesuino Rodolpho do Regó Monteiro and Maria Ignacia do Régo Monteiro.
Private secretary to Ruy Barbosa, then Minister of Finance of the Provisional Government, 1889-1891. Official of the Ministry of Public Instruction, 18901891. Secretary of the Jornal do Brasil of Rio de Janeiro, 1893.
Editor of the Jornal do Commercio of Rio de Janeiro, 1894- 1907.
Accompanied President Campos Salles (as his secretary and as correspondent for the Jornal do Commercio) on his visit to England, Italy, Germany, Portugal, and France. Returned to England in 1902 as special correspondent of the Jornal do Commercio at the coronation of Edward VII.
Secretary-general of the Industrial Center of Brazil, 19071912. In Paris, on business and financial matters, from 1912 to the outbreak of war.
Led a pro-Ally campaign in the Brazilian press
Federal senator from the State of Rio Grande do Norte, 1920— 1922.

Academy of Sciences of Lisbon (corresponding). Capistrano de Abreu Society (director). Brazilian Jockey Club of Rio de Janeiro.
Decorations: Officier de la Légion d’Honneur of France.
